(Image source: … WebMay 10, 2024 · An example of a 1:1 converter supplying 200 volts DC to a 600 Ω load (66.667 watts): - When the input voltage is 273 volts, we are still just about in CCM. You can see this on the image above; the load power is 66.667 watts and the boundary power transfer limit that can be delivered is 66.624 watts.

WebThe LT3825 simplifies and improves the performance of low voltage, multi-output flyback supplies by providing precise synchronous rectifier timing and eliminating the need for … WebJul 29, 2024 · In the standard form of a flyback converter, the leakage inductance of the transformer creates a voltage spike on the drain of the primary field-effect transistor (FET). Preventing this spike from becoming excessive and damaging, the FET requires a clamping network, usually with a dissipative clamp, as shown in Figure 1 .
